Thumbs up Messing around with a 318 "///M"



Ok, so was coming back home from a friend's house (the one that gets me BMW parts at employee cost). So, I get to this light, and see a gorgeous M5 coming from the right and turn onto the street I was in. Light turns green and I try to get behind what I thought from a distance was that same M5, as I get closer I notice something weird about the "M" emblem and see that it's actually a 318 (the exahust) and I see the M5 turning left . But anyhow, the guy in the 318 had noticed my car and was flashing his brakes, in my head am thinking ( ) so, light turns green, the cars in front of him go and he floors it, trying to lose me, and right behind him the all time, we zig-zag our way past the next light.

At this point he does something like this out of his window and points to me to come right next to him. So, I get right next to him, and his buddy asks me "What you got under the hood" "My car's M52 powered with a few mods, you got a 318 right?" The driver answers "how did you know" "look at your exhaust". I guess that kinda pissed him off bcs I think he tried to floor it, but obviously couldn't lose me, I tap the gas a bit harder, and go
